Caring Hospice Services in Mount Laurel is a unique, holistic and cost effective service designed to meet the social, emotional, spiritual and physical needs of their patients and families as they face terminal illness. The mission of Caring Hospice Services is to coordinate patient and family services while respecting their choices, values and beliefs.

Caring Hospice Services has patients in communities throughout southern New Jersey who are in need of friendly visits from people willing to give a few hours per month. Their patients reside in private homes, nursing homes and assisted-living facilities throughout Atlantic, Burlington, Camden, Cumberland, Gloucester and Salem Counties.

Patient Visitor Volunteers help by providing companionship and a social outlet to patients. Volunteers visit on a regular basis to talk, listen, offer presence, play games or share simple activities with the patient. Caring Hospice Services will find a way to share your talents and interests with their patients and families.

Individualized training is provided free of charge without the need to travel to the Mount Laurel office. In keeping with Medicare requirements, background, DMV and medical checks are part of the training process. Schedule is completely flexible.
